The Ultimate Guide to Finding Cheap Power Tools Online Without Sacrificing Quality

For DIY enthusiasts, woodworkers, and professional contractors alike, building a reputable collection of power tools can rapidly become a pricey venture. High-end brand names frequently come with premium cost tags, making it hard for enthusiasts on a budget plan to get going. Fortunately, the digital market has actually revolutionized how customers store. Buying cheap power tools online is easier than ever, however navigating the huge sea of e-commerce requires a strategic method to make sure security, resilience, and worth for money.

This thorough guide explores where to look, what to search for, and how to score the best deals on power tools throughout the web.

Why Buy Power Tools Online?

Traditional brick-and-mortar hardware stores have high overhead expenses, which are frequently given to the consumer in the form of greater costs. Online sellers, on the other hand, use numerous unique advantages:

  • Price Transparency: Consumers can quickly compare costs throughout numerous websites within seconds.
  • Large Selection: Online platforms offer access to niche brand names, global producers, and hard-to-find specialty tools that local shops might not stock.
  • Access to Reviews: Buyers can read hundreds of genuine consumer reviews and see video presentations before purchasing.
  • Unique Online Deals: Many producers and merchants provide web-only discount rates, clearance events, and bundled promotions.

Where to Find Cheap Power Tools Online

Not all online sellers are produced equal. Knowing where to shop is half the fight when searching for bargain power tools.

1. Big-Box Retailer Website Clearance Sections

Significant home improvement stores like The Home Depot, Lowe's, and Harbor Freight function devoted clearance and "Special Buy of the Day" sections on their websites. These platforms regularly slash costs on overstocked inventory or outbound design years.

2. Dedicated Tool Outlets and Liquidation Sites

Websites like CPO Outlets and Acme Tools concentrate on reconditioned, factory-certified, and clearance tools. In addition, online liquidators offer pallet returns from significant retailers at a portion of the retail cost-- ideal for purchasers going to test and possibly troubleshoot small problems.

3. General E-Commerce Giants

Amazon and eBay remain huge centers for power tools. Nevertheless, shoppers must work out care here, guaranteeing they buy from licensed dealers or reliable stores to prevent counterfeit products.

New vs. Reconditioned vs. Used: Which Should You Buy?

When looking for inexpensive power tools online, comprehending the condition classifications can save buyers money while mitigating danger.

Discovering the least expensive price isn't almost clicking "include to haul." Smart online shoppers use particular tactics to optimize their cost savings.

  • Usage Price Tracking Tools: Browser extensions like Honey or CamelCamelCamel enable buyers to track rate history on Amazon and other websites, making sure the "sale" price is really a bargain.
  • Try To Find Tool-Only Bundles: If a collection of cordless tool batteries is already owned, purchasing "tool-only" (bare tool) versions without batteries and chargers can slash costs by 40% to 50%.
  • Check for Manufacturer Rebates: Many tool brand names run seasonal mail-in or online refunds, offering money back or totally free batteries with select online purchases.
  • Register for Newsletters: Subscribing to favorite tool outlet newsletters frequently yields a 10% to 15% discount rate code on the very first order.

Risks to Avoid When Buying Cheap Tools Online

While conserving cash is amazing, ultra-cheap tools can sometimes provide safety risks or break down prematurely. Keep these warnings in mind:

  • Beware of "No-Name" Brands: If an online listing features an unpronounceable trademark name with hundreds of luxury reviews composed in damaged English, continue with care. These are frequently low-quality dropshipped products.
  • Consider Shipping Costs: A tool that looks incredibly inexpensive might have expensive shipping costs attached at checkout. Always try to find totally free shipping thresholds.
  • Inspect the Return Policy: Buying online means not having the ability to hold the tool initially. Ensure the seller has a problem-free return policy in case the Tool Shops Near Me feels improperly balanced or stops working upon arrival.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Are cheap online power tools safe to utilize?

It depends on the brand and the source. Low-cost tools from reliable spending plan brand names (like Ryobi, SKIL, or Porter-Cable) or reconditioned name-brand tools are normally really safe. However, unbranded, ultra-cheap imports might do not have correct safety accreditations (such as UL or ETL listings), posturing electrical or mechanical threats.

What is a factory-certified reconditioned tool?

A reconditioned tool is a product that was returned to the producer, frequently due to a minor flaw, cosmetic blemish, or merely due to the fact that a client altered their mind. The manufacturer examines, repairs, tests, and repackages the tool to ensure it fulfills initial factory requirements, normally offering it at a substantial discount.

Is it better to purchase corded or cordless tools on a budget plan?

For spending plan buyers, corded tools are usually less expensive and provide more constant Power Tool Suppliers UK than entry-level cordless tools. Cordless tools require financial investment in batteries, which can drive up the cost. Nevertheless, if versatility and movement are needed, try to find entry-level 18V or 20V cordless communities where one battery fits several tools.

How can I spot counterfeit power tools online?

Fakes are most common on third-party marketplaces like eBay or Amazon marketplace. To avoid them, purchase directly from licensed merchants, check for official holographic seals on packaging, and be cautious of prices that appear "too great to be true" for high-end brands like Makita, DeWalt, or Milwaukee.

Constructing a robust workshop does not require clearing a savings account. By leveraging online clearance events, exploring factory-reconditioned options, and sticking to reliable budget brand names, DIYers can get trusted devices without breaking the bank. Always do your research, read client reviews, and focus on safety above all else when hunting for cheap power tools online.
